B3: Distributed systems - 840D sl only
2.3 Examples
Different systems of units
Different systems of units are possible in spite of an active link group, as long as no cross
NCU interpolation takes place. The system of units settings are made for a specific NCU in
the part program or synchronous action using G commands (
References
Function Manual, Basic Functions; Velocities, Setpoint-Actual Value Systems, Closed-Loop
Control (G2)
2.3
Examples
2.3.1
Link axis
Parameter example for two NCUs each with a link axis
NCU1
Machine data
General link data:
$MN_NCU_LINKNO = 1
$MN_MM_NCU_LINK_MASK = 1
$MN_MM_SERVO_FIFO_SIZE = 3
$MN_MM_LINK_NUM_OF_MODULES = 2
Logical machine axis image (LAI):
$MN_AXCONF_LOGIC_MACHAX_TAB[0] = "AX1"
$MN_AXCONF_LOGIC_MACHAX_TAB[1] = "AX2"
$MN_AXCONF_LOGIC_MACHAX_TAB[2] = "NC2_AX3"
Machine axis name, unique system-wide as NCU identifier:
$MN_AXCONF_MACHAX_NAME_TAB[0] = "NC1_A1"
$MN_AXCONF_MACHAX_NAME_TAB[1] = "NC1_A2"
$MN_AXCONF_MACHAX_NAME_TAB[2] = "NC1_A3"
Assignment of channel axis to machine axis:
$MC_AXCONF_MACHAX_USED[0] = 1
$MC_AXCONF_MACHAX_USED[1] = 2
$MC_AXCONF_MACHAX_USED[2]=3
122
Note
Master NCU
Set NCU-link active
Size of the data buffer between interpolation and position
control
Number of link modules
Local machine axis
Local machine axis
Link axis
1. Channel axis to the machine axis of LAI[0]
2. Channel axis to the machine axis of LAI[1]
3. Channel axis to the machine axis of LAI[2]
Function Manual, 03/2013, 6FC5397-1BP40-3BA1
,
,
,
).
G70
G71
G700
G710
Extended Functions